It depends on what you mean 'hang with'. On trails the 250x can pretty well hang right with those quads. If you're talking about flat out drag racing, forget beating any of your friends quads with the 250X except for maybe the 300EX. You wouldn't be left behind though for about anything other than racing. My sons 250X hangs right with my Scrambler unless were on a straight flat stretch and even then he's not far behind. It's a nice quad.
